送货至:

 

 

mcs-51单片机与24lc系列的接口技术

 

2024-02-03 09:35:06

晨欣小编

MCS-51单片机是一种经典的8位微处理器,被广泛应用于各种嵌入式系统中。而24LC系列是一种串行EEPROM(Electrically Erasable Programmable Read-Only Memory),能够提供非易失性存储。这两者之间的接口技术是非常重要的,因为它们的结合能够在嵌入式系统中实现数据的存储和读取。

在MCS-51单片机与24LC系列之间建立接口的主要方式是通过I2C总线协议。I2C是一种串行通信协议,由Philips公司于1982年开发。它允许多个设备(如单片机和EEPROM)通过两根总线线路(SDA和SCL)进行双向通信。

为了建立MCS-51单片机与24LC系列之间的I2C接口,首先需要在单片机电路中连接SDA和SCL线路。SDA线连接到MCS-51单片机的P2.0引脚,而SCL线连接到P2.1引脚。这些引脚可以通过软件编程进行配置,以确保它们与I2C总线通信兼容。

接下来,需要通过编程来实现MCS-51单片机与24LC系列之间的读写操作。首先,需要发送一个起始信号(Start)以通知24LC系列开始接收数据。然后,发送24LC系列的设备地址和读写位,以指定要读取还是写入数据。设备地址是24LC系列的唯一标识符,可以选择的范围是0x50到0x57。根据需要,可以将读写位设置为0或1。

一旦设备地址和读写位被发送,可以开始向24LC系列发送数据或从24LC系列读取数据。在数据传输期间,MCS-51单片机需要产生适当的时钟信号以确保数据同步。数据传输完成后,可以发送停止信号(Stop),以表明数据传输结束。

除了基本的读写操作外,还可以使用一些附加功能来增强MCS-51单片机与24LC系列之间的接口。例如,可以使用页写入(Page Write)功能来一次性写入多个字节的数据,从而提高写入数据的效率。还可以使用写使能寄存器(Write Enable Register)来保护EEPROM中的数据,防止误操作。这些功能都可以通过编程来实现,并根据具体需求进行配置。

总结起来,MCS-51单片机与24LC系列之间的接口技术基于I2C总线协议,通过适当的硬件连接和软件编程实现数据的存储和读取。这种接口技术为嵌入式系统提供了非易失性存储能力,并且具有灵活性和可扩展性。通过合理利用附加功能,可以进一步提高接口性能和可靠性。因此,掌握这种接口技术对于开发嵌入式系统来说是至关重要的。

G


 

上一篇: 驿唐gprsdtu连接wincc------驿唐gprsdtu连接wincc
下一篇: 74系列芯片引脚图资料大全

热点资讯 - IC芯片

 

251R15S200FV4E参数信息
251R15S200FV4E参数信息
2025-07-02 | 1143 阅读
STM32F401CCU6参数与数据手册
STM32F401CCU6参数与数据手册
2025-06-25 | 1032 阅读
电芯模拟器的作用
电芯模拟器的作用
2025-06-17 | 1091 阅读
TMS320VC5409GGU-80 BGA 德州仪器中文资料
小功率线性稳压芯片选型
小功率线性稳压芯片选型
2025-05-16 | 1279 阅读
LP2985-33DBVR中文资料
LP2985-33DBVR中文资料
2025-05-16 | 1061 阅读
TI LDO芯片推荐
TI LDO芯片推荐
2025-05-16 | 1212 阅读
LP2985-33DBVR中文资料_PDF数据手册_参数_引脚图
收起 展开
QQ客服
我的专属客服
工作时间

周一至周六:09:00-12:00

13:30-18:30

投诉电话:0755-82566015

微信客服

扫一扫,加我微信

0 优惠券 0 购物车 BOM配单 我的询价 TOP